`
绿色滑板鞋
  • 浏览: 81661 次
  • 性别: Icon_minigender_1
社区版块
存档分类
最新评论

6大类14款数据可视化工具,学会其中2个就够了!

阅读更多

经常有人问有哪些好看的数据可视化工具推荐?

针对这个问题,先来总结一下,比方说下面这张图:

6大类14款数据可视化工具,学会其中2个就够了!

 

1、可以用PS+AI画图形来做。我经常让设计师童鞋帮我做设计稿,参考着样式、布局,自己在用Echarts或者BI工具实现。一般这话总方式用于新闻报道、杂志排版,所谓信息可视化,偏注重结论,分析过程大多躺在excel里。

2、图表插件Echarts、Highcharts、AntV、D3... 会点程序很重要,主要四JS,常用于前端网页实现,开发一些产品工具的时候可能会集成这些开源的可视化插件(这里Highcharts不开源啊)。

3、现成的一些图表工具、BI工具。Excel牛的话,Excel就可以实现。或者直接用Tableau、FineBI、DOMO等BI工具。

4、数据挖掘编程语言,R和Python,有可视化包,需要协会这两种语言,难度有点高,如何想学数据分析和数据挖掘的可以直接学这两种语言。

以上,对于简单用用,入门小白,BI工具是最简单的,但也要视自己能基础和使用场景。

接下来具体讲讲这几个工具的使用和各自的优点

纯可视化图表生成/图表插件——适合开发,工程师

Echarts

一个纯Javascript的数据可视化库,百度的产品,常应用于软件产品开发或网页的统计图表模块。可在Web端高度定制可视化图表,图表种类多,动态可视化效,各类图表各类形式都完全开源免费。能处理大数据量和3D绘图也不逊色,据说结合百度地图的使用很出色。

6大类14款数据可视化工具,学会其中2个就够了!

 

Echart还是多用于一些开发场景的,但它也衍生了一个0代码的图表生成器 —“百度图说”,我体验了下,操作基本上就是选择图标,把数据复制过去,然后生成图表,保存为图或者代码嵌入。

6大类14款数据可视化工具,学会其中2个就够了!

 

AntV

AntV又是蚂蚁金服出品(阿里系)的一套数据可视化语法,貌似是国内第一个采用The grammar Of Graphics这套理论的可视化库。antv带有一系列的数据处理API,简单数据的数据归类,分析的能力,被很多大公司用作自己BI平台的底层工具。

6大类14款数据可视化工具,学会其中2个就够了!

 

Highcharts

说道Echarts,都会拿来与Hicharts对比,两者有点像WPS和OFFICE的关系,倒不是说Echarts怎样,日常图表动效Echarts完全够了。

Highcharts同样是可视化库,只不过是国外的,商用的话需要付费。其优势是文档详细, 实例也很很详细,文档中依赖哪些js脚本,css都十分详细,学习和开发都比较省时省力,相应的产品稳定性较强。

6大类14款数据可视化工具,学会其中2个就够了!

 

可视化报表类——适合报表开发、BI工程师

FineReport

一个报表软件,企业级的应用。用于系统的开发业务报表,数据分析报表。也可集成在OA,ERP,CRM等应用系统内,做数据报表模块,也可以开发成财务分析系统,就看你如何驾驭数据了。

两大核心功能是填报和数据展示,但我觉得比较惊艳的一点是,它内置了大量的图表和可视化动效,可视化很丰富,完全没有印象中做报表那种古板的风格。多以它能做出格式各样的dashboard、甚至是可视化大屏,一点不虚。

我之前工作有段时间拿finereport,感触最深的是开发报表很省力,10张门店报表以往做10张excel的,在他里面就是一个参数查询,然后批量导出,用一个模板。

所以有号称:工作用小屏,决策用大屏。办公用微软,经营用帆软。

6大类14款数据可视化工具,学会其中2个就够了!

 

6大类14款数据可视化工具,学会其中2个就够了!

 

商业智能分析——适合BI工程师、数据分析师

Tableau

几乎是数据分析师人人会提的工具,内置常用的分析图表,和一些数据分析模型,可以快速的探索式数据分析,制作数据分析报告。

因为是商业智能,解决的问题更偏向商业分析,用 Tableau可以快速地做出动态交互图,并且图表和配色也非常拿得出手。

6大类14款数据可视化工具,学会其中2个就够了!

 

FineBI

自助是BI工具,也是一款成熟的数据分析产品。内置丰富图表,不需要代码调用,可直接拖拽生成。可用于业务数据的快速分析,制作dashboard,也可构建可视化大屏。

有别于Tableau的是,它更倾向于企业应用,从内置的ETL功能以及数据处理方式上看出,侧重业务数据的快速分析以及可视化展现。可与大数据平台,各类多维数据库结合,所以在企业级BI应用上广泛,个人使用免费。

6大类14款数据可视化工具,学会其中2个就够了!

 

6大类14款数据可视化工具,学会其中2个就够了!

 

PowerBI

微软继Excel之后推出的BI产品,可以和Excel无缝连接使用,创建个性化的数据看板。

6大类14款数据可视化工具,学会其中2个就够了!

 

数据地图类

很多工具都能实现数据地图,比如上面提到的Echarts、finereport、tableau等。

这里强烈安利的Power Map 2016,可以快速体验一把爽。

6大类14款数据可视化工具,学会其中2个就够了!

 

还有比较快速的,地图慧

内置的是百度地图,选择模板、上传数据、保存地图很简单的3步。

6大类14款数据可视化工具,学会其中2个就够了!

 

可视化大屏类

阿里DataV

天猫双十一大屏就用DataV做的,是阿里云的拖拽式可视化工具,主要用于业务数据与地理信息融合的大数据可视化,像一些展览中心,企业管控中心用。

不需要编程,通过简单的拖拽配置就能生成可视化大屏或者仪表盘。

6大类14款数据可视化工具,学会其中2个就够了!

 

FineReport

上面提过,这个工具它也能做可视化报表,也能做大屏。

因为后端通常连接业务系统数据,所以可以实时连接业务数据,做企业的一些经营数据展示。比如展览中心、BOSS驾驶舱,还有城市交通管控中心、交易大厅等。

6大类14款数据可视化工具,学会其中2个就够了!

 

数字冰雹

产品技术不了解,也只是有幸在一次活动上见过。

专注于做数据图像、三维处理、数据分析等相关业务,通过图像可视化方式呈现数据分析,在智慧城市、工业监控用的比较多。

就是商业的,不过官网上有很多大屏设计,可以提供灵感。

6大类14款数据可视化工具,学会其中2个就够了!

 

数据挖掘编程语言——适合技术性数据分析师、数据科学家

典型如R和Python

R-ggplot2

6大类14款数据可视化工具,学会其中2个就够了!

 

0
0
分享到:
评论

相关推荐

    厦门大学-林子雨-大数据技术基础-第9章数据可视化-上机练习-可视化工具Tableau操作实践

    可视化工具Tableau操作实践 旨在让学生了解Tableau这款可视化工具,学会简单操作Tableau以及制作简单的图表。

    可视化程序设计(VB)课件_东北大学

    课程名称:可视化程序设计(VB) 一、课程的性质和任务 VISUAL BASIC程序设计是一门理论与实践相结合,偏重于应用的课程。其主要课程内容包括VB程序设计语言概述,VB集成开发环境简介,面向对象程序设计方法简介,VB...

    Python 爬虫-数据可视化

    是一款工具,它允许用户通过可视化的方式抓取网站数据,无需任何编程知识。使用Portia时,您可以对网页进行注解,标识出希望提取的数据内容,然后Portia将根据这些注解理解并学会如何从类似的页面中抓取数据

    Python数据殿堂:数据分析与数据可视化

    【入门基础+轻实战演示】【讲授方式轻松幽默、有趣不枯燥、案例与实操结合,与相关课程差异化】利用python进行数据处理、 ...通过实战,学生将了解标准的数据分析流程,学会使用可视化的 方法展示数据及结果。

    IDL可视化工具入门与提高

    通过本书的学习,IDL的初学者可以掌握IDL的基础语法、数组的有效使用以及利用IDL实现可视化编程的基础知识,而IDL的中高级读者则可以学会如何编写易于理解而又高效的IDL程序,并且从中获得大量的实践经验。...

    3天从零快速搭建BI商业大数据分析平台视频教程

    1.4 DataGrip可视化工具部署 1.5 DataGrip与MySQL连接配置 第二章:SQL分析之DDL 2.1 SQL的分类与规则 2.2 DDL之数据库管理 2.3 DDL之数据表创建与查询 2.4 DDL之数据表删除与描述 第三章:SQL分析之DML 3.1 DML之...

    Python实现时间序列可视化的方法

    matplotlib库是一个用于创建出版质量图表的桌面绘图包(2D绘图库),是Python中最基本的可视化工具。 【工具】Python 3 【数据】Tushare 【注】示例注重的是方法的讲解,请大家灵活掌握。 1.单个时间序列 首先,我们...

    Excel 2007数据透视表完全剖析 1/7

    本书首先介绍了数据透视表的基础,然后逐步介绍创建数据透视表、自定义透视表、查看视图数据、在透视表内进行计算、使用数据透视图等可视化工具、分析数据源、共享数据表、使用和分析OLAP数据、在透视表中使用宏和...

    Python数据分析可视化—你不学会后悔的图表绘制工具Matplotlib图表样式参数

    上一篇博客简单介绍了一下Matplotlib的图表窗口和图表基本元素,这一篇着重写一下Matplotlib图表的样式参数 (1)linestyle参数 linestyle是选择线型,即虚线还是直线等,...plt.plot([i**2 for i in range(100)], lin

    android开发——简易计算器的设计报告.doc

    简易计算机的设计 摘要:Android是当今最重要的手机开发平台之一,它是建立在Java基础之上的,能 够迅速建立手机软件的解决方案。Android的功能十分强大,成为当今软件行业的一股新 兴力量。Android基于Linux平台,...

    Python深入数据处理实战探险-视频教程网盘链接提取码下载 .txt

    深入数据分析:我们将深入...本课程适合数据分析师、数据科学家、业务分析师以及任何对数据处理和可视化感兴趣的人员。无论您是初学者还是有经验的数据专业人员,本课程都将提供您所需的知识和技能。 视频大小:4.3G

    Java数据结构和算法中文第二版(1)

    Java数据结构和算法中文第二版(2) 【内容简介】 本书可帮助读者: 通过由基于JAVA的演示所组成的可视专题讨论来掌握数据结构和算法 学会如何为常见和不太常见的编程条件选择正确的算法 利用数据结构和算法为...

    Excel 2007数据透视表完全剖析 3/7

    本书首先介绍了数据透视表的基础,然后逐步介绍创建数据透视表、自定义透视表、查看视图数据、在透视表内进行计算、使用数据透视图等可视化工具、分析数据源、共享数据表、使用和分析OLAP数据、在透视表中使用宏和...

    Excel 2007数据透视表完全剖析 4/7

    本书首先介绍了数据透视表的基础,然后逐步介绍创建数据透视表、自定义透视表、查看视图数据、在透视表内进行计算、使用数据透视图等可视化工具、分析数据源、共享数据表、使用和分析OLAP数据、在透视表中使用宏和...

    用Python进行数据分析

    •利用matplotlib创建散点图以及静态或交互式的可视化结果。 •利用pandas的groupby功能对数据集进行切片、切块和汇总操作。 •处理各种各样的时间序列数据。 •通过详细的案例学习如何解决Web分析、社会科学、金融...

    matlab-5套实验源码-绘图&数据统计&方程最优化问题&数值积分与符号计算.zip

    绘图实验:这个实验主要介绍了如何使用Matlab进行数据可视化,包括绘制二维图形、三维图形、动态图形等。通过这个实验,用户可以学会如何利用Matlab的绘图功能来展示数据和分析结果。 数据统计实验:这个实验主要...

    671-毕设-基于python的疫情数据可视化分析系统-源码-LW-PPT.rar

    数据库工具:Navicat11 开发软件:PyCharm 浏览器:谷歌浏览器 Python链接:https://pan.baidu.com/s/15HJSpG7GCHNmAFp0B8nrDQ 提取码:0000 后台路径地址:localhost:8080/项目名称/admin/dist/index.html ...

    Java数据结构和算法中文第二版(2)

    通过由基于JAVA的演示所组成的可视专题讨论来掌握数据结构和算法 学会如何为常见和不太常见的编程条件选择正确的算法 利用数据结构和算法为现实世界的处理过程建模 了解不同的数据结构的优势和弱点,考虑如何利用...

    2019数据运营思维导图

    怎么做 数据收集 数据太多可以采用抽样的方法 数据建模 根据所获取到的数据建立模型,注入数据调整模型参数 数据分析及预测 数据可视化、输出报表、趋势预测 留存分析 留存(次~7日、14日、30日) 解决问题 用户对...

    数据运营思维导图

    数据可视化、输出报表、趋势预测 留存分析 留存(次~7日、14日、30日) 解决问题 用户对游戏的适应性 用户对于游戏的粘性 评估渠道用户的质量、投放渠道效果评估 新增用户什么时候流失在加剧? 注意事项 ...

Global site tag (gtag.js) - Google Analytics